Ivan Bortnik visited the facilities of the innovative infrastructure of the Republic of Tatarstan

21 September 2017, Thursday

Today, Deputy Minister of the Economy, Bulat Khaziakhmetov, and the Adviser to the Director-General of the Fund for the promotion of small forms of enterprises in science and technology, Ivan Bortnik, who is visiting Kazan, visited a number of innovative infrastructure facilities, designed to develop child and youth innovation activities.

The Centre of Youth Innovation Creativity "Hakspace", located on the basis of a boarding school No.2 in the Moscow District of Kazan is among them. The centre is equipped with modern high-tech equipment, where children can obtain research skills and realize their first innovative ideas.

The delegation also visited and studied the activities of the Lycée No. 35 of the Volga District of Kazan, where the Aerospace Education Centre is operating. The main directions of activity of the Centre are: scientific-research and engineering-technology activities, aviation and space technology management, personal and physical education of children. The centre is the base site for implementation of the project "Country of Aviation", which consolidated Children's organizations in nine settlements of the Republic of Tatarstan.

In addition, a meeting was held with schoolchildren and students, participants and winners of the "Sirius" project at the "Idea" site of the innovation and production technology park. Ivan Bortnik told to the audience about the contest "UMNIK-Sirius", which iss being implemented in the scope of the program of The Fund for Innovations' Promotion "Participant of youth scientific innovative contest" ('UMNIK"). The purpose of the competition is to promotion and implementation of innovative projects, sponsored by the recipients of grants from the President of the Russian Federation. Ivan Bortnik called on the younger generation to participate more actively in this and other competitions under The Fund for Innovations' Promotion, enabling to translate into reality their bold innovative ideas.
